What is Kingdom Monera?
The eubacteria, archaebacteria, and blue-green bacteria (or cyanobacteria) which form Kingdom Monera lack the cellular organization that all other living organisms possess: an organized nucleus, double membrane bound organelles, and sexual reproduction that leads to genetic recombination. Other contrasting characteristics of Kingdom Monera members include: biochemical differences in the makeup of the cell walls and DNA, lack of microtubules, and differences in the structure of their flagella.
